Aspie Recipes: Sugar Cookies with Cream Cheese Frosting

Picture1wopwpw

I wanted to do a simple and quick recipe that I know you would enjoy.  Why not make some simple homemade sugar cookies with a cream cheese frosting on top.  These cookies were soft and chewy!  This could be something you can do during the long Memorial Day weekend!  Here’s what you need:

For the frosting:

  • 8 oz. cream cheese
  • 8 tbsp. butter, softened
  • 1 tbsp. vanilla extract
  • 4 cups confectioners sugar
  • 2 tbsp. milk

1. Preheat oven to 375 degrees. In a small bowl, stir together flour, baking soda, and baking powder.

cookie 004

2. In a large b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until smooth. Beat in egg and vanilla. Gradually blend in the dry ingredients.

cookie 002

3. Scoop spoonfuls of dough and place onto a baking sheet; then bake for around 10 minutes.

cookie 031

4. Combine powdered sugar, cream cheese, vanilla extract, softened butter, and milk in a bowl and mix well.

cookie 029

5.  After letting cookies cool completely, place some frosting on each cookie.

cookie 033

Enjoy!  These were good!
